Building an email list is essential for any business looking to connect with its audience and drive sales.

As you collect email addresses from interested individuals, you can deliver targeted messages and promotions that encourage engagement and conversions.

One of the most effective ways to build your email list is by offering white papers and ebooks.

These resources provide valuable information to your target audience while also encouraging them to provide their email address in exchange for access.

In this blog post, we’ll explore some tips and best practices for using white papers and ebooks to build your email list.

Your landing page is the page where your target audience will provide their email address in exchange for access to your resource.

It’s important to optimize your landing page to encourage conversions and maximize the effectiveness of your white paper or ebook.
